Vertex Pharmaceuticals ($NASDAQ:VRTX) Incorporated is a global biotechnology company dedicated to the discovery, development, and commercialization of innovative therapies that bring hope to people living with serious diseases. In recent years, Vertex has made major advances in the treatment of cystic fibrosis, a life-threatening genetic disorder, and has launched several drugs for the treatment of this disease. – Incyte Corp ($NASDAQ:INCY)
Incyte Corporation is a Wilmington, Delaware-based biopharmaceutical company that focuses on the discovery, development, and commercialization of proprietary small molecule drugs to treat serious unmet medical needs, primarily in oncology.
As of 2022, Incyte Corporation had a market capitalization of $15.48 billion and a return on equity of 9.54%. The company’s main product is Jakafi (ruxolitinib), which is approved for the treatment of myelofibrosis and polycythemia vera, two rare blood disorders. Incyte is also developing several other drugs in clinical trials for various cancers.
